Join the Leukaemia Foundation on Wednesday 16th September at an inspiring annual event ‘Light the Night'. With two family friendly events held simultaneously in Western Australia; Foreshore Reserve, Riverside Drive in Perth and a regional event at Bicentennial Square in Bunbury, participants each receive a balloon containing a tiny light.
Gold balloons to remember a loved one lost, white balloons to celebrate being a blood cancer survivor and blue balloons to give hope for a brighter future through research.
The evening commences with on stage entertainment, fun for the kids and food vendors on site. Participants then Light the Night on a gentle 3.5km twilight walk. Light the Night also has a fundraising component to ensure ongoing support for patients and living with blood cancers such as leukaemia, lymphoma and myeloma. Be seen in a good light.
